NEET eligibility criteria by nta mentions nothing about appearing for improvement examination, but yes as per eligibility criteria by NTA for jee mains when one appears for improvement examination then he has to appear in all the five subjects otherwise it is not considered.
So, to be on the safer side to be eligible for your Neet examination if you are planning to give your 12th examination again I would suggest you to give examination of all the 5 subjects- physics chemistry biology English and one more subject like Hindi Sanskrit Maths or any other subject of your choice . You can even go for NIOS on demand examination for this 12th exam and don't worry NIOS is a recognised board and it is accepted for Neet examination.
Neet 2021 eligibility criteria says that, to be eligible one must be either appearing for the class 12th board examination 2021 or one must have passed 12th board examination with physics, chemistry ,biology/biotechnology and English and must have got at least 50 % in aggregate of PCB i.e Physics, Chemistry and Biology/Biotechnology in 12th examination if belongs to general category , or at least 40% in aggregate of PCB if belongs to Obc/ Sc /st category , or at least 45 % in aggregate of PCB in case of general pwd candidates to be eligible. So, after passing if you fulfill this percentage requirement in PCB as per your category then you will be eligible for Neet examination and after qualifying Neet examination you can get admission in MBBS BDS Ayush courses like BAMS, BHMS, veterinary i. e BVSc on the basis of marks/ rank obtained by you in NEET examination.
Also, to be eligible for neet 2021 one has to be at least 17 years old or more by 31st December 2021

See percentage of class 12th is merely an eligibility criteria for appearing in JEE-Main/JEE-Advance and without appearing in JEE-Main/JEE-Advance you are not eligible for admission in B.Tech. courses in NITs/IITs/IIITs. You must have passed your class 12th from recognized central/state board and should have secured minimum 75% marks with Physics, Mathematics and Chemistry as mandatory subjects.
Note that JEE-Main is compulsory to qualify to become eligible for JEE-Advance and then admission to B.Tech. courses offered by IITs.
